Ajit Pawar says meeting of Maharashtra's delegation with Amit Shah postponed

Meeting between Maharashtra Deputy CM Ajit Pawar, Chief Minister Eknath Shinde, and Deputy CM Devendra Fadnavis with Union Home Minister Amit Shah postponed.

Maharashtra Deputy Chief Minister Ajit Pawar informed that a planned meeting with Union Home Minister Amit Shah, including Chief Minister Eknath Shinde and Deputy CM Devendra Fadnavis, had been postponed. The scheduled evening meeting, which was to take place during the state legislature`s ongoing winter session at Vidhan Bhavan in Nagpur, was deferred due to pressing commitments on Shah`s part.

Addressing journalists, Pawar mentioned receiving a message from Shah citing unavoidable tasks, leading to the postponement of the meeting. Shah proposed rescheduling the interaction for Monday or Tuesday, with the Maharashtra delegation requesting time on Monday. "We have sought his time on Monday," Pawar said.
